Supported languages

Use Willo in your own language

Willo is localised for the following languages:

  • Arabic (العربية )
  • Chinese Simplified (中文 Zhōngwén)
  • Chinese Traditional (繁體中文)
  • Dutch (Nederlands)
  • English
  • French (Français)
  • German (Deutsch )
  • Indonesian (Bahasa Indonesia)
  • Italian (Italiano)
  • Japanese (日本語)
  • Korean (한국인 )
  • Russian (Русский)
  • Spanish (Español)
  • Ukrainian (Українська)
  • Haitian Creole
  • Hindi (हिन्दी, हिंदी)
  • Greek (Ελληνικά )
  • Welsh (Cymraeg)


Language not listed?

If we don't natively support it, you can still use Willo in your own language with the help of Google Translate.

Computer

  • Open your Willo interview in Google Chrome
  • In the top corner, you will see a translate icon

  • Click this and select your preferred language
  • Then refresh the page and your Willo interview will be in whatever language you prefer

Not working? Try refreshing the web page. If it’s still not working, right-click anywhere on the page. Then, click Translate to [Language].

Android

  • On your Android phone or tablet, open the Chrome app Chrome.
  • Go to a web page written in another language.
  • At the bottom, select the language that you want to translate to.
  • To change the default language, tap More and then 'More languages' and select the language.
If you don’t find Translate at the bottom of a page, you can request a translation.
  • On your Android phone or tablet, open the Chrome app Chrome.
  • To the right of the address bar, tap More More and then Translate…

Not working? Try refreshing the web page. If you still can't tap Translate, the language might not be available for translation.

iPhone & iPad

  • On your iPhone or iPad, open the Chrome app Chrome.
  • Go to a web page written in another language.
  • At the bottom, select the language that you want to translate to.
  • To change the default language, tap Settings and then 'More languages' and select the language.
Request translation in Chrome
  • If you don’t find Translate at the bottom of a page, you can request a translation.
  • On your iPhone or iPad, open the Chrome app Chrome.
  • On the bottom right, tap More and then Translate.

Not working? Try refreshing the web page. If you still can't tap Translate, the language might not be available for translation.
